实验3实验报告_第1页
实验3实验报告_第2页
实验3实验报告_第3页
实验3实验报告_第4页
免费预览已结束,剩余1页可下载查看

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、实验3实验报告安徽机电职业技术学院实验报告课程名称网络数据库sql server2005 实验名称实验三数据表的建立系部信息工程系班级姓名学号实验时间 2009年月日时分时分地点机位评语指导教师:汪峰坤成绩一、实验目的1、掌握sql server 2005中各种数据类型的特点。2、掌握用户自定义数据类型的创建方法。3、理解标识列的特点并掌握其使用方法。4、理解主键、外键和默认值等的特定以及使用方法。5、掌握表的创建方法。6、掌握查看表的方法。7、掌握修改、添加和删除列的方法。8、掌握删除表的方法。二、实验内容1、掌握使用sql server management studio建立数据表。2、掌

2、握使用t-sql语言建立数据表。3、掌握使用t-sql语言定义主键、默认值、计算列等。4、掌握查看表信息方法。三、实验步骤(根据要求作答问题或写出实验步骤,可适当截图配合说明)题目:实践练习注意,首先在c盘根目录创建文件夹teaching,执行以下脚本:-创建数据库teachingdbuse mastergoif exists(select * from sys.databases where name=teachingdb) drop database teachingdbgocreate database teachingdbon primary(name=pfile1,filename=

3、c:teachingpfile1data.mdf,size=4mb,maxsize=50mb,filegrowth=1mb),filegroup ugroup1 (name=g1file1, filename=c:teachingg1file1data.ndf,size=2mb,maxsize=50mb,filegrowth=1mb),(name=g1file2,filename=c:teachingg1file2data.ndf,size=2mb,maxsize=50mb,filegrowth=1mb),filegroup ugroup2(name=g2file1,filename=c:te

4、achingg2file1data.ndf,size=1mb,maxsize=50mb,filegrowth=1mb)log on(name=logfile1,filename=c:teachinglogfile1.ldf,size=2mb,maxsize=50mb,filegrowth=1mb)go-将ugroup1修改为默认文件组alter database teachingdbmodify filegroup ugroup1 defaultgo创建数据库teachingdb并将用户自定义文件组ugroup1设置为默认文件组。1、使用transact-sql在数据库teachingdb中定

5、义数据类型namechar,该数据类型使用的基本数据类型为nvarchar,宽度为50,允许有空值。(请写出相应的t-sql语句)答案: 2、使用transact-sql在数据库teachingdb中定义表departments,该表的特定见表4-9。 表4-9 departments表的特点列名数据类型允许空约束其他dptcode nchar(4) 主键dptname nvarchar(50) 答案:3、使用transact-sql在数据库teachingdb中定义表students,该表的特定见表4-10。表4-10 students表的特点列名数据类型允许空约束其他sudid int 主

6、键标识列stdname namechar dob datetime gender nchar(2) default 男classcode nchar(4)dptcode nchar(4) 外键答案: 4、使用transact-sql修改students表的结构,在该表中增加一个新列age,该列是一个计算列,计算表达式为year(getdate()-year(dob)。 答案:5、使用可视化工具在teachingdb数据库中创建表classes,该表的特定见表4-11。表4-11 classes表的特点列名数据类型允许空约束其他classcode nchar(4) 主键classname nvarchar(50) dptcode nchar(4) 外键答案: 6、使用可视化工具修改students表的结构,在该表的classcode列上添加一个外键约束,参照classes表中的主键列classcode。 答案:7、使用t-sql语句查看建立数据表的信息。(请写出相应的t-sql语句并对结果截图) 8、使用t-sql语句查看建立数据表classes的列信息。(请写出相应的t-sql语句并对结果截图) 四、收获,体会及问题(写

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论